Start with the saved example
The Stripe example is a dated company snapshot. Download its CSV and open it before importing. It demonstrates the handoff format, not current company verification. Check the domain, column names and employee estimate so you know which values will enter your table.
02
Choose your Clay destination
Clay documents CSV imports into a new or existing table. Select the CSV source, upload the file and choose the destination. Existing-table imports require column mapping. Interface labels can change; the linked Clay documentation is the current reference.
03
Map identity first
Map domain to the company website field and name to the company-name field. Preserve founding year and employee range in separate columns. Keep the estimated range as text; converting it to a single number would introduce a value the source never supplied.
04
Review before enrichment
Check the imported row against the original CSV. A successful import proves that data arrived, not that the data is correct. If Clay offers automatic enrichment for new rows, review that choice and its costs before enabling it.
05
Plan repeated imports
Keep a stable domain identifier and a source date in your own workflow. Decide how to handle duplicates before importing another file. This example does not configure an update key, recurring job or two-way synchronization for you.
06
Measure a useful outcome
Use the imported facts to reduce repeated manual entry or prepare an account question. Record corrections and missing values. Clay credits and The Spawn executions belong to separate cost records; this manual example does not establish a total automated cost per enriched row.
